What are CIT files?
A CIT file represents a black-and-white raster image created using an Intergraph Security, Government and Infrastructure (SG&I) piece of software. Until a few years ago, Intergraph was considered one of largest software developers in the world, and is part of Hexagon AB since 2010. The company provides IT services all over the world to governments and businesses, and apart from the SG&I division it also includes one called Process, Power & Marine (PP&M) and another called Hexagon Geospatial.
What are GBR files?
GBR is part of the Gerber group of formats — a set of standardized extensions used in the printed circuit board (PCB) industry. Gerber files include 2-D representations of various PCB images, such as copper layers, solder mask etc. They can also describe the electrical connections on such boards, or drilling and milling info associated with them. Similar formats include GBS, CMP and SOL.
